According to industry sources, Nvidia is considering changing the high-bandwidth memory solution for the next generation Rubin Ultra artificial intelligence accelerator to adjust the previous 12-layer stack to 8 layers. In the context of rising storage costs, Nvidia is paying more attention to the cost per bandwidth and the economy of the whole machine system.
